BlockBlueLight PowerPanel Mini
The BlockBlueLight PowerPanel Mini is a red light therapy panel with 2 wavelengths (660nm, 850nm). The brand states 100 mW/cm² at 6 inches without naming the measurement instrument. It is priced at $500.

FDA status: FDA-registered - described accurately by the brand.

Irradiance in context

The BlockBlueLight PowerPanel Mini lists 100 mW/cm² at 6 inches. Brand-line testing note (may reference other models in the BlockBlueLight line): Dual-disclosed: solar meter AND spectrometer at 6 in (e.g., MAX 162 solar / 82 spectrometer) - transparent With both surface reds (660nm) and deeper near-infrared (850nm), it is built to cover skin-level and deeper muscle or joint work. Run your real distance and this figure through the dose calculator to land inside a studied 10 to 60 J/cm² range; if the number is method-unstated or solar-meter based, treat roughly half of it as the working value.

Is the BlockBlueLight PowerPanel Mini FDA approved?

No home red light therapy panel is FDA approved. Its regulatory position per the brand: FDA-registered - described accurately by the brand. Registration is a listing, not a clearance.
